Llegada (Arrival)

So far so good. Actually great! The upgrade to business class from Chicago to Barcelona was awesome: gourmet food and desserts, fully reclining seats, personal tv screens, complimentary travel kits, warm wet clothes, free champagne and wine. I also got to share the ridiculous experience with a girl named Jennifer who also got bumped up. It was a lot of fun.
My connection went pretty smoothly and I made it safely to Barcelona. I absolutely love my apartment. It's very spacious with a foyer, living room with couches and a tv, a dining room, a kitchen/laundry room, a half bath, a full bath, and 4 bedrooms. Here's the even better part...I'm the only one other than the live-in RA who got a single room! My own space....My roommates are really nice and the RA is very friendly and understanding too. She's 26 and a native to Barcelona so she definitely knows what is going on. I also just found out that besides me and my 4 other female roommates there are only 3 other males in the Spanish Language Apartment Program - much smaller and more competitive than I thought. It's gonna be great, I'm already learning so much and gaining more confidence in my speaking abilities. Two of my roommates are practically already fluent because they grew up with the language...I can only hope I'll get there too.
Today me and one of my roommates Kelly explored a little bit of Barcelona and ate at a tapas restaurant. The city is so unique and beautiful at the same time (and I've only seen a small section of it)! The avenues criss-cross everywhere but running down the middle is a park-like tree -ined walking/biking path. The urban planning might drive Dad nuts but you'd have to appreciate the effort gone into making a city more attractive. There's wonderful architecture at every turn and I can't wait to explore beyond the walking radius.
